We had a very successful drive at the Malibu Temple yesterday. Sarayu's sister Kala and my wife Suvasini were the prime movers behind the drive. As late as Wednesday we weren't sure things would come together in time for Saturday, but something told us that we should not miss the opportunity of Ganesh Chathurthi. Kala had made arrangements with the temple authorities. We got the NMDP cheek swab kits and training on Thursday and coordinated with our batchmates and other volunteers on Friday.
Besides our batch mates, Bala, Bapa Rao, Mots and Sammy, we had Kala and her mother, Suvasini, Dr. Lakshmi Dhanvantari and her twin daughter Anita and Sonya, Yatin Mody (IITM '82?), Shantha Kumar (wife of Dr. Ravi Kumar of USC, IITM '74 Jamuna Hostel), and Elise Latewic (friend of Suvasini and Shantha from Pasadena).
We had Ted Nguyen from A3M (Asians for Miracle Marrow Match (http://www.asianmarrow.org/) join us. This helped us set up two separate tables to ensure a more leak-proof way to catch the traffic.
Bapa Rao's daughter Dana, Mots's daughter Priya, Dr. Dhanvatari's daughters Anita and Sonya, and my daughter Sheila gave all of us hope for the next generation by really rising to the occasion. In the beginning they were a little shy, but soon they got into the swing of it, and towards the end of the day, they had devised several process improvements and had no hesitation in offering persuasive arguments to convince unsure would be donors. Great lessons in learning wonderful life skills for all the youngsters.
Suvasini, Kala and her mother made sure that all the volunteers were fed lunch and Dr. Lakshmi Dhanvatari was kind enough to do a Starbucks run.
Many of us got to talk to Prak and Sujju over the phone in the middle of the drive. Prak was in fine mid season form as far as his joking went. His counts have come up nicely from the time he got hospitalized at the start of the week and he was feeling better.
Between A3M and us, we collected over 320 samples. Let us hope one of those is a match.Clearly we can not rest. More drives are being planned and many of us also intend to join other drives like the big drive planned by A3M for October 14 in Cerritos.
